The windwind collision (WWC) in eccentric massive binary systems producespredictably variable shockheated Xray plasma. This collision provides an ideallaboratory for shock astrophysics, providing key constraints on how gasthermalizes at variable density and on particle acceleration. Joint NuSTAR andXMMNewton observation of WR 140 in AO14 discovered an extremely hard Xraycomponent, which can originate either from a kT virgul13 keV plasma orinverseCompton scattering. WR 140 will experience its periastron passage in2016 Dec., a critical time when the WWC emission changes dramatically. Wepropose joint NuSTAR and XMMNewton observations of WR 140 at key phases aroundperiastron in AO15, to determine the origin of this component and answer questions about the abrupt Xray flux decrease. truncated!, Please see actual data for full text [truncated!, Please see actual data for full text]
